Ill. Admin. Code tit. 8 § 900.703

Current through Register Vol. 48, No. 24, June 14, 2024
Section 900.703 - Level of Surety
a) The level of surety is determined by the following formula:

Level of Surety = (V x CF) + EC

where:

V

=

Volume of the lagoon as constructed or modified, in cubic feet, including the freeboard volume

CF

=

Cost factor determined pursuant to subsection (b) of this Section

EC

=

Engineering contingency determined under subsection (c) of this Section

b) The cost factor is obtained from the following:
1) Through December 31, 2002, the cost factor is 10 cents per cubic foot of lagoon volume.
2) On and after January 1, 2003 through December 31, 2007, the cost factor is 12 cents per cubic foot of lagoon volume.
3) On and after January 1, 2008, the cost factor is 15 cents per cubic foot of lagoon volume.
c) The engineering contingency is equal to 10% of (V x CF).
